# Break-Glass: Catalog Cache Invalidation

Scope: the Pinrow product catalog at Veldstone Retail. If stale prices persist after a purge and the Hollowmere invalidation queue is wedged, use break-glass to flush the edge tier directly. Contractors: get verbal sign-off from the catalog lead first. Steps: open the Hollowmere admin shell, select emergency-flush, confirm the tenant, and run it once — repeated flushes thrash the origin. Access is logged and expires after 20 minutes. Unseal the admin shell with the passphrase below.

recovery phrase for kahop-tajog: istix-casvan

Handover note for the release manager: I'm passing the font-vendoring work on Brightgale to Soren's team. All third-party typefaces (the Quillmont and Harrowtype families) are now vendored into the assets repo rather than fetched at build time, which removes the flaky CDN dependency from release builds. License files sit alongside each family and must ship with every release artifact. The subsetting script runs in CI and fails the build if glyph coverage drops. The pipeline reads its settings from the block below.

deployment values, kajep-kageg:
[praix]
host = praix.paliqcorp.corp
user = praix_svc
database = praix_prod

## Artifact Signing: BloomGate Cache Layer

Quick note for Thursday's sync: we now sign the bloom filter snapshots that sit in front of Kestrel-KV, same as any other artifact. If the filter blob fails verification, nodes fall back to direct store reads (slower, but safe). Rebuild jobs pick up the key from the vault automatically. For manual verification during an incident, use the signing key shown here.

signing key of bagap-yawep = bky13_TbfT6ZMUoGJo2